Charles Henrich writes:

> Yes but think about it, .forwards WILL NOT WORK USUALLY EVER if sendmail
> doesnt read .forward's as root!  Most home directories are 700!  This is a
> *bug* not a feature.

sarah:~ % pwd 
/var/home/imb
sarah:~ % cd ..
sarah:/var/home % ls -ld imb
drwx------  18 imb  staff  2048 Apr 21 05:35 imb
sarah:/var/home % cd 
sarah:~ % ll .forward 
-rw-rw-r--  1 imb  staff  20 Feb 16 02:56 .forward
sarah:~ % cat .forward 
\imb
imb@scgt.oz.au

 .. works just fine for me on -stable with sendmail 8.7.5 and no overrides
on where .forward files can be, i.e. default sendmail configuration,
